Abstract

An apparatus for ventilating the cabin of a locomotive wherein the ducts serve both a ventilating and a structural function. Horizontal duct provides support for floor in place of one or more of the regularly spaced joists. Horizontal duct may include stringers recessed into sound absorbing insulation within the duct. Vertical duct is formed in part from a portion of a wall of the control compartment of the locomotive cabin, thereby eliminating the need for separate wall sections. The space saved by using such structures for dual purposes may be used to increase the cross-sectional area of the ventilating apparatus, thereby allowing the speed of fan to be reduced to provide the desired ventilation at a reduced level of sound.
